WinXP and Outlook 2003 - email on Exchange Server. We
have one user, "Toni," who cannot receive new email msgs.
(WinXP & Outlook 2003). All new msg's were being
direcrted to a "Sync Error" folder. She now receives
nothing at all. There are three other users set up on
this machine - they receive msg's on this same machine
without incident. Also, I can get "Toni's" messages on
other machines, just not this one.
A Microsoft article recommended renaming the .ost file (by
renaming as .OLD) and Outlook would create a new .ost
file. This did nothing. Another said to synchronize
the "Inbox" folder. No result there either.
I have deleted and recreated her profile - no luck. She
can send email, just cannot receive. Also, her older
messages (received prior to this problem) still sit in
her "inbox" folder.
Even uninstalled and reinstalled Office - still no luck.
What's so puzzling to me is that other users are OK on
THIS machine & she is OK on OTHER machines. I'm stuck!!!
